HOGAN, Judge.
Raymond Karl Lassen, 17 years of age, stands convicted of the murder of William R. Melvin, Jr., in the commission of a robbery. Such criminal action constitutes first-degree murder, § 565.003, RSMo 1978, and defendant's punishment has been assessed at imprisonment for life.
